當前位置:編程學習大全網 - 編程語言 - 如何學習壹門編程語言?

如何學習壹門編程語言?

如何學編程語言?很多人喜歡爭論什麽編程語言好,我認為這個話題如果不限定應用範圍,就毫無意義。每種編程語言必然有其優點和缺點,這也決定了它有適合的應用場景和不適合的應用場景。現代軟件行業,想壹門編程語言包打天下是不現實的。這種現狀也造成了壹種現象,壹個程序員往往要掌握多種編程語言。

學習任何壹門編程語言,都會面臨的第壹個問題都是:如何學習這門語言?我覺得有必要談談的是:如何由淺入深的學習壹門編程語言?學習所有編程語言有沒有壹個相對統壹的學習方法?

下面,北大青鳥回龍觀計算機學院總結壹下,學習編程語言的基本步驟。

01、基本語法

首先當然是了解語言的最基本語法。

控制臺輸出,如C的printf,Java的System.out.println等。普通程序員的第壹行代碼壹般都是輸出“HelloWorld”吧。

基本數據類型

不同編程語言的基本數據類型不同。基本數據類型是的申請內存空間變得方便、規範化。

變量

不同編程語言的聲明變量方式有很大不同。有的如Java、C++需要明確指定變量數據類型,這種叫強類型定義語言。有的語言(主要是腳本語言),如Javascript、Shell等,不需要明確指定數據類型,這種叫若類型定義語言。

還需要註意的壹點是變量的作用域範圍和生命周期。不同語言變量的作用域範圍和生命周期不壹定壹樣,這個需要在代碼中細細體會,有時會為此埋雷。

邏輯控制語句

編程語言都會有邏輯控制語句,哪怕是匯編語言。掌握條件語句、循環語句、中斷循環語句(break、continue)、選擇語句。壹般區別僅僅在於關鍵字、語法格式略有不同

函數

編程語言基本都有函數。註意語法格式:是否支持出參;支持哪些數據作為入參,有些語言允許將函數作為參數傳入另壹個參數(即回調);返回值;如何退出函數(如Java、C++的return,)。

  • 上一篇:唯獨偏愛德系高管?捷豹路虎CEO繼任者即將揭曉
  • 下一篇:QQ語音通訊軟件采用的語音壓縮標準
  • copyright 2024編程學習大全網